
Mr Universe by Rich Goodson
Poetry. California Interest. Rich Goodson's debut pamphlet wryly interrogates the male body--and finds it to be a place of risk and narcissism, shame and sensual epiphany. It begins with Vladimir Putin urinating and ends with an Australian mechanic's avowal of love. In between are Viking swords, terrorism, cosmetic surgery, Daniel Craig--and God disguised as a wasp. The voice is mischievous, restless and visceral. Its sensuousness belies the urgent nature of the interrogation: to ask what--if anything--the male body means.
"Goodson's poems will demand your attention. His is a worldview opened up by a questing and questioning sense of his own and others' masculinity, utterly physical in its efforts to look beyond materiality. This is not an incoherent manliness, struck dumb by its own swagger--on the contrary, in variety of form and tone, Goodson's poems are judicious to the point of delicacy. They're as taut as a dancer's calf."--Gregory Woods
